Structure of the nearest-neighbor environment of Li+ ion in aqueous solutions of its salts
Description
Experimental X-ray diffraction data on structural characteristics of lithium ion hydration in aqueous solutions of its salts are summarized and correlated with the published data obtained by various methods. Structural parameters of the nearest-neighbor environment of Li+ ion, viz., coordination number, interparticle distances, and ion association types are discussed
